Senior Quantity Surveyor - Residential Groundworks

Description

We are seeking a highly motivated Senior Quantity Surveyor to join a dynamic team in the civil engineering industry. As a Senior Quantity Surveyor, you will play an integral role in managing all aspects of project costs from initiation through to completion. You will be responsible for accurately estimating project costs, preparing tender documents, and assessing contracts. Utilizing your expertise, you will analyze financial outcomes and ensure that projects are completed within budget, while maintaining quality and efficiency. Your role will involve close collaboration with Project Managers, Engineers and Contractors to provide sound advice on procurement strategies and cost-effective solutions. You will conduct risk assessments and prepare reports, offering insights to stakeholders to assist in decision-making.

Responsibilities

  • Prepare detailed cost estimates for civil engineering projects
  • Assist in the preparation of tender documents and contracts
  • Evaluate contractor quotes and proposals to ensure best value
  • Monitor project budgets and provide financial reporting to stakeholders
  • Conduct regular site visits to assess progress and costs
  • Advise on procurement strategies and cost control measures
  • Engage with architects, engineers, and clients to ensure project alignment

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Quantity Surveying, Civil Engineering, or related field
  • Proven experience as a Quantity Surveyor in the residential groundworks sector
  • Strong knowledge of sub contracting, construction methods and regulations
  • Proficiency in cost estimation software and project management tools
  •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ills
  • Strong communication and negotiation skills
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team
